Margaret "Marge" (Riley) Lefevre, 74, of Whitesboro, NY, passed away with her family by her side on Monday, January 2, 2023.
She was born January 8, 1948, in Altoona, PA. The daughter of the late James Riley & Jean (George) Riley of Utica, NY. She was educated locally at UCA and was self-employed as a house cleaner for 30 years.
Marge was a devout Roman Catholic who loved teaching religious education class at St. John the Baptist, Rome, NY and volunteered at many local church bazars. She enjoyed annual vacations at Brantingham Lake with her family and adored spending time with her four grandsons.
Marge is survived by her four children, Amy Lefevre of New Hartford, NY, Eden Lefevre of Rome, NY, Joseph Lefevre of Latham, NY, and Lauren (James) Loisell of Barneveld, NY; and her grandchildren.
Relatives and friends are respectfully invited to attend a Mass of Christian Burial at St. Paul's Catholic Church in Whitesboro, NY on Saturday, January 7, 2023 at 9:30 am. Interment will be in Grandview Cemetery.
The Family would like to thank the 3rd floor Nursing staff at St. Elizabeth Medical Center for their exemplary care and kindness shown during her time there.
Funeral arrangements are with the Mark C. Bentz Funeral Service, Inc., New Hartford, NY.
